The prayer called Tachnun that is said every day except Shabbos and Yomim Toivim, has additional exemptions that are clearly outlined in the Shulchan Aruch.
One of those exemptions is if someone makes a bris. The Shulchan goes as far to say that all minyonim of the building that hosts the bris shouldn't say Tachnun!
